EXCEEDS logo
Exceeds
Nikolas Logan

PROFILE

Nikolas Logan

Nikolas Logan contributed to the OpenFUSIONToolkit/JPEC repository by delivering features and improvements focused on automation, documentation, and code safety. He implemented GitHub Actions workflows using YAML and Julia to automate issue triage and code reviews, integrating Claude AI for consistent quality and faster response times. Nikolas enhanced documentation for ODE core functions, clarifying initialization and solution vector transformations to improve maintainability and onboarding. He addressed code safety by adding annotation warnings for wall coordinate handling, aligning with legacy Fortran logic to reduce runtime errors. His work demonstrated depth in AI integration, workflow automation, scientific computing, and software documentation practices.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

6Total
Bugs
1
Commits
6
Features
3
Lines of code
111
Activity Months4

Your Network

119 people

Shared Repositories

21
Aaron FroeseMember
Aaron FroeseMember
JaebeomChoMember
Daniel BurgessMember
d-burgMember
Dylan BrennanMember
Dylan BrennanMember
Dylan BrennanMember
Jake HalpernMember

Work History

January 2026

1 Commits

Jan 1, 2026

January 2026 monthly summary for OpenFUSIONToolkit/JPEC: Delivered a code-safety enhancement by adding an annotation warning for wall coordinate handling, aligning with legacy Fortran logic to mitigate singularities and reduce runtime errors. This work improves maintainability and cross-language consistency, establishing a foundation for future edge-case handling improvements.

December 2025

2 Commits • 1 Features

Dec 1, 2025

December 2025: Delivered Claude AI automation for the OpenFUSIONToolkit/JPEC repository to automate issue handling and code reviews via GitHub Actions, improving triage speed, consistency, and overall code quality. Implemented two workflows that automate responses, actions on issues/comments, and automated code reviews with a focus on quality, performance, security, and test coverage. These changes reduce manual toil and enable faster, higher-quality delivery.

October 2025

2 Commits • 1 Features

Oct 1, 2025

Month: 2025-10 — OpenFUSIONToolkit/JPEC monthly summary focusing on key accomplishments, business value, and technical achievements. Key features delivered: - ODE core documentation improvements: clarified initialization in the ode_axis_init! function and the purpose of transforming solution vectors during the ODE run function to improve readability and maintainability. Major bugs fixed: - None reported for this repository in 2025-10. (No bug fixes recorded in this period for OpenFUSIONToolkit/JPEC.) Overall impact and accomplishments: - Improved maintainability and onboarding through clearer documentation and inline annotations, enabling faster contributor ramp-up and reducing future maintenance costs. - Provided clearer guidance on ODE core usage, reducing ambiguity for downstream integrations and users. Technologies/skills demonstrated: - Documentation best practices and code annotation (Rust-like macros in ode_axis_init!, and documentation alignment). - Traceable, commit-level improvement (referenced commits 8eadbd0f6415436ec45671af9d2efa238e62ab96 and 96a14bfd9cb96361ea5bb9eb3bedf76993442000).

August 2025

1 Commits • 1 Features

Aug 1, 2025

2025-08 monthly summary for OpenFUSIONToolkit/JPEC. Key feature delivered: Licensing Information Update to reflect new affiliation. No major bugs fixed this month for this repo. Overall impact: improved licensing accuracy, brand alignment, and compliance, reducing risk and enabling smoother external partnerships. Technologies/skills demonstrated: git/version control, licensing governance, repository auditing, change management, and cross-functional coordination.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age46.6%

Skills & Technologies

Programming Languages

JuliaYAML

Technical Skills

AI IntegrationDevOpsGitHub ActionsJulia programmingWorkflow Automationdata analysisnumerical methodsscientific computingsoftware documentation

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

OpenFUSIONToolkit/JPEC

Aug 2025 Jan 2026
4 Months active

Languages Used

JuliaYAML

Technical Skills

Julia programmingdata analysisnumerical methodsscientific computingAI IntegrationDevOps